Oxidative Stress and Your Skin: What You Need to Know

What is Oxidative Stress?

Oxidative stress occurs when there’s an imbalance between reactive oxygen species (ROS) — commonly called free radicals — and the body’s antioxidant defenses. While free radicals are natural byproducts of metabolism and even play useful roles in signaling and immunity, excess amounts can overwhelm the system. When antioxidants are insufficient to restore balance, oxidative stress develops and can lead to cellular and tissue damage.

What Causes Oxidative Stress in Skin?

Oxidative stress in the skin can arise from both intrinsic (internal) and extrinsic (environmental) factors:

  • Intrinsic factors: normal cellular metabolism, natural aging, and inflammation.
  • Extrinsic factors:
    • UV radiation (sun exposure) ☀️ – the strongest and best-documented trigger of skin oxidative stress.
    • Pollution 🌫️ – airborne particles and ozone generate ROS and have been linked to pigmentation and barrier damage.
    • Blue light (HEV) 💻 – studies suggest it can induce ROS and pigmentation, though the evidence is still emerging compared to UV.
    • Smoking 🚬 – cigarette smoke is a major source of free radicals, associated with collagen breakdown and premature aging.
    • Alcohol 🍷 – contributes to systemic oxidative stress; effects on skin are less studied but likely play a role.

How Does Oxidative Stress Affect Skin?

Excessive oxidative stress in the skin is linked to a range of visible and functional changes:

  • Pigmentation and dark spots 🎯 – ROS overstimulate melanocytes, leading to uneven tone.
  • Premature aging ⏳ – oxidative stress accelerates collagen and elastin breakdown, contributing to fine lines and wrinkles.
  • Barrier weakening 🛡️ – lipid peroxidation compromises the skin’s protective barrier.
  • Inflammation 🔥 – ROS activate inflammatory pathways, worsening sensitivity.
  • Dullness 😶 – oxidative stress can damage skin proteins and lipids, making your skin look tired and less radiant.

The Role of Antioxidant Skincare

Topical antioxidants can help neutralize excess ROS and support the skin’s defense system. Evidence supports the use of ingredients like:

  • Vitamin C & Vitamin E – protect against photodamage when used individually and synergistically.
  • Polyphenols  – shown to reduce markers of oxidative stress in skin.
  • Niacinamide – supports barrier repair and reduces oxidative and inflammatory responses.

The Antioxidant Potential of Seaweeds

Seaweeds are nature’s resilient marine superstars, naturally producing powerful antioxidants to survive harsh ocean conditions like intense UV, waves, and oxygen-rich waters. They contain protective molecules such as phlorotannins, carotenoids, tocopherols, and polysaccharides, which research and cosmetic studies show can:

  • Neutralize free radicals, protecting skin from oxidative stress that leads to dullness, pigmentation, and premature aging.
  • Strengthen the skin barrier, keeping it hydrated and resilient against environmental aggressors.
  • Calm oxidative stress, reducing redness, irritation, and cellular stress after exposure to pollution or UV.
